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1 and 10. To get the overall score you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of them. We use a weighted review system, which means the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. Guests can also give separate “subscores” in crucial areas like location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an accommodation that you booked through our platform if you stayed there, or if you got to the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ialize in detecting fake reviews submitted to our plat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team so that our fraud team can investigate.

To make sure reviews are relevant, we may only accept reviews that are submitted within 3 months of checking out. We may stop showing reviews once they’re 36 months old, or if the accommodation has a change of ownership.
An accommodation can reply to a review.
When you see multiple reviews, the most recent ones will be at the top, subject to a few other factors (e.g. language, whether it’s just a rating or contains comments as well, etc.). You can sort and/or filter them by time of year, review score, and more.
Sometimes we show external review scores from other well-known travel websites, but make it clear when we do this.

Olly
United KingdomAll minor points but: The communal kitchen was practically nonexistent, it was tiny, so only a couple of people could cook at any one time. Consequently, options were limited. The beds have hard metal frames that can be tough to climb if on the top bunk & there’s lots of squeaky floorboards, which can make being quiet difficult when moving around certain dorms. Not many communal loos or showers for the whole hostal to share.
Friendly and helpful staff always on hand to answer any queries. Laundry service available and on site food/bar for meals was a nice option to have instead of cooking always. Locked dorms and lockers inside was good for security & all beds have curtains for privacy, as well as lights and a socket point to charge your electronics. In a decent area, a short walk to several amenities and shops. I stayed more than once.
